CVS: cvs.openbsd.org: src

2020-02-02 Thread Darren Tucker
CVSROOT:/cvs
Module name:src
Changes by: dtuc...@cvs.openbsd.org 2020/02/02 02:45:34

Modified files:
usr.bin/ssh: clientloop.c 

Log message:
Output (none) in debug in the case in the CheckHostIP=no case as
suggested by markus@



CVS: cvs.openbsd.org: src

2020-02-02 Thread Darren Tucker
CVSROOT:/cvs
Module name:src
Changes by: dtuc...@cvs.openbsd.org 2020/02/02 02:22:22

Modified files:
usr.bin/ssh: clientloop.c 

Log message:
Prevent possible null pointer deref of ip_str in debug.



CVS: cvs.openbsd.org: src

2020-02-02 Thread Theo de Raadt
CVSROOT:/cvs
Module name:src
Changes by: dera...@cvs.openbsd.org 2020/02/02 11:55:47

Modified files:
sys/arch/arm64/arm64: locore.S 

Log message:
Reapply post-svc-sled in a repaired fashion.  The SYS_sigreturn-related
sigcoderet label must point directly after the svc instruction, because the
sigreturn() checks it as SROP mitigation, so place the sled after the label.
tested by naddy



CVS: cvs.openbsd.org: src

2020-02-02 Thread Christian Weisgerber
CVSROOT:/cvs
Module name:src
Changes by: na...@cvs.openbsd.org   2020/02/02 11:01:39

Modified files:
sys/arch/arm64/arm64: locore.S 

Log message:
Back out previous "insert two nop instructions after svc instructions
for SYS_exit and SYS_sigreturn in the sigtramp"; init has trouble
spawning processes.



CVS: cvs.openbsd.org: src

2020-02-02 Thread Kenneth R Westerback
CVSROOT:/cvs
Module name:src
Changes by: k...@cvs.openbsd.org2020/02/02 13:33:52

Modified files:
distrib/miniroot: install.sub 
sbin/dhclient  : clparse.c 

Log message:
Tweak dhclient(8) timing defaults depending on SMALL rather than using
/dev/stdin to fake a dhclient.conf file during install. Simplifies and
shortens install.sub code. Allows further restrictions to be applied
to '-c' specified files.



CVS: cvs.openbsd.org: src

2020-02-02 Thread Alexander Bluhm
CVSROOT:/cvs
Module name:src
Changes by: bl...@cvs.openbsd.org   2020/02/02 13:18:17

Modified files:
regress/lib/libc/sys: Makefile t_ptrace.c 

Log message:
Add missing new line to printf.  Make clean should not require SUDO.



CVS: cvs.openbsd.org: src

2020-02-02 Thread Alexander Bluhm
CVSROOT:/cvs
Module name:src
Changes by: bl...@cvs.openbsd.org   2020/02/02 14:01:53

Modified files:
regress/sys/net/pf_forward: Makefile 

Log message:
Since OpenBSD has switched to the strict host model, this regress
needs IP forwarding enabled on the packet source machine.  Otherwise
the pf reply-to test fails.



CVS: cvs.openbsd.org: www

2020-02-02 Thread Stuart Henderson
CVSROOT:/cvs
Module name:www
Changes by: st...@cvs.openbsd.org   2020/02/02 14:45:39

Modified files:
.  : ftp.html ftplist httpslist 
openbgpd   : ftp.html 
openssh: ftp.html portable.html 
openntpd   : portable.html 

Log message:
sync



CVS: cvs.openbsd.org: www

2020-02-02 Thread Stuart Henderson
CVSROOT:/cvs
Module name:www
Changes by: st...@cvs.openbsd.org   2020/02/02 14:44:42

Modified files:
build  : mirrors.dat 

Log message:
give mirror.planetunix.net one more try, requested by mirror operator
Brian Brombacher.



CVS: cvs.openbsd.org: src

2020-02-02 Thread Gilles Chehade
CVSROOT:/cvs
Module name:src
Changes by: gil...@cvs.openbsd.org  2020/02/02 15:13:48

Modified files:
usr.sbin/smtpd : mail.lmtp.c mda_unpriv.c parse.y 

Log message:
add SENDER to mda environment and teach lmtp to use that instead of command
line parameter. this allows simplifying lmtp command line and it would have
prevented the unpriv command exec for LMTP in recent advisory.

ok millert@ and jung@



CVS: cvs.openbsd.org: src

2020-02-02 Thread Todd C . Miller
CVSROOT:/cvs
Module name:src
Changes by: mill...@cvs.openbsd.org 2020/02/02 16:17:09

Modified files:
libexec/mail.local: locking.c mail.local.c mail.local.h 

Log message:
Allow mail.local to be run as non-root.
If mail.local is invoked by a non-root user, open a pipe to
lockspool(1) for file locking.  It is only possible to delivery to
a pre-existing mail spool when running mail.local as non-root.
OK gilles@ deraadt@